Use proper caution when opening attachments, clicking links, or responding. >>> >>> >>> Fix an OOM panic in XDP_DRV mode when a XDP program shrinks a >>> multi-buffer packet by 4k bytes and then redirects it to an AF_XDP >>> socket. >>> >>> Since support for handling multi-buffer frames was added to XDP, usage >>> of bpf_xdp_adjust_tail() helper within XDP program can free the page >>> that given fragment occupies and in turn decrease the fragment count >>> within skb_shared_info that is embedded in xdp_buff struct. In current >>> ice driver codebase, it can become problematic when page recycling logic >>> decides not to reuse the page. In such case, __page_frag_cache_drain() >>> is used with ice_rx_buf::pagecnt_bias that was not adjusted after >>> refcount of page was changed by XDP prog which in turn does not drain >>> the refcount to 0 and page is never freed. >>> >>> To address this, let us store the count of frags before the XDP program >>> was executed on Rx ring struct. This will be used to compare with >>> current frag count from skb_shared_info embedded in xdp_buff. A smaller >>> value in the latter indicates that XDP prog freed frag(s). Then, for >>> given delta decrement pagecnt_bias for XDP_DROP verdict. >>> >>> While at it, let us also handle the EOP frag within >>> ice_set_rx_bufs_act() to make our life easier, so all of the adjustments >>> needed to be applied against freed frags are performed in the single >>> place. >>> >>> Fixes: 2fba7dc5157b ("ice: Add support for XDP multi-buffer on Rx side") >>> Acked-by: Magnus Karlsson >>> Signed-off-by: Maciej Fijalkowski >>> --- >>> drivers/net/ethernet/intel/ice/ice_txrx.c | 14 ++++++--- >>> drivers/net/ethernet/intel/ice/ice_txrx.h | 1 + >>> drivers/net/ethernet/intel/ice/ice_txrx_lib.h | 31 +++++++++++++------ >>> 3 files changed, 32 insertions(+), 14 deletions(-) >>> >>> diff --git a/drivers/net/ethernet/intel/ice/ice_txrx.c b/drivers/net/ethernet/intel/ice/ice_txrx.c >>> index 74d13cc5a3a7..0c9b4aa8a049 100644 >>> --- a/drivers/net/ethernet/intel/ice/ice_txrx.c >>> +++ b/drivers/net/ethernet/intel/ice/ice_txrx.c >>> @@ -603,9 +603,7 @@ ice_run_xdp(struct ice_rx_ring *rx_ring, struct xdp_buff *xdp, >>> ret = ICE_XDP_CONSUMED; >>> } >>> exit: >>> - rx_buf->act = ret; >>> - if (unlikely(xdp_buff_has_frags(xdp))) >>> - ice_set_rx_bufs_act(xdp, rx_ring, ret); >>> + ice_set_rx_bufs_act(xdp, rx_ring, ret); >>> } >>> >>> /** >>> @@ -893,14 +891,17 @@ ice_add_xdp_frag(struct ice_rx_ring *rx_ring, struct xdp_buff *xdp, >>> } >>> >>> if (unlikely(sinfo->nr_frags == MAX_SKB_FRAGS)) { >>> - if (unlikely(xdp_buff_has_frags(xdp))) >>> - ice_set_rx_bufs_act(xdp, rx_ring, ICE_XDP_CONSUMED); >>> + ice_set_rx_bufs_act(xdp, rx_ring, ICE_XDP_CONSUMED); >>> return -ENOMEM; >>> } >>> >>> __skb_fill_page_desc_noacc(sinfo, sinfo->nr_frags++, rx_buf->page, >>> rx_buf->page_offset, size); >>> sinfo->xdp_frags_size += size; >>> + /* remember frag count before XDP prog execution; bpf_xdp_adjust_tail() >>> + * can pop off frags but driver has to handle it on its own >>> + */ >>> + rx_ring->nr_frags = sinfo->nr_frags; >>> >>> if (page_is_pfmemalloc(rx_buf->page)) >>> xdp_buff_set_frag_pfmemalloc(xdp); >>> @@ -1251,6 +1252,7 @@ int ice_clean_rx_irq(struct ice_rx_ring *rx_ring, int budget) >>> >>> xdp->data = NULL; >>> rx_ring->first_desc = ntc; >>> + rx_ring->nr_frags = 0; >>> continue; >>> construct_skb: >>> if (likely(ice_ring_uses_build_skb(rx_ring))) >>> @@ -1266,10 +1268,12 @@ int ice_clean_rx_irq(struct ice_rx_ring *rx_ring, int budget) >>> ICE_XDP_CONSUMED); >>> xdp->data = NULL; >>> rx_ring->first_desc = ntc; >>> + rx_ring->nr_frags = 0; >>> break; >>> } >>> xdp->data = NULL; >>> rx_ring->first_desc = ntc; >>> + rx_ring->nr_frags = 0; >>> >>> stat_err_bits = BIT(ICE_RX_FLEX_DESC_STATUS0_RXE_S); >>> if (unlikely(ice_test_staterr(rx_desc->wb.status_error0, >>> diff --git a/drivers/net/ethernet/intel/ice/ice_txrx.h b/drivers/net/ethernet/intel/ice/ice_txrx.h >>> index b3379ff73674..af955b0e5dc5 100644 >>> --- a/drivers/net/ethernet/intel/ice/ice_txrx.h >>> +++ b/drivers/net/ethernet/intel/ice/ice_txrx.h >>> @@ -358,6 +358,7 @@ struct ice_rx_ring { >>> struct ice_tx_ring *xdp_ring; >>> struct ice_rx_ring *next; /* pointer to next ring in q_vector */ >>> struct xsk_buff_pool *xsk_pool; >>> + u32 nr_frags; >>> dma_addr_t dma; /* physical address of ring */ >>> u16 rx_buf_len; >>> u8 dcb_tc; /* Traffic class of ring */ >>> diff --git a/drivers/net/ethernet/intel/ice/ice_txrx_lib.h b/drivers/net/ethernet/intel/ice/ice_txrx_lib.h >>> index 762047508619..afcead4baef4 100644 >>> --- a/drivers/net/ethernet/intel/ice/ice_txrx_lib.h >>> +++ b/drivers/net/ethernet/intel/ice/ice_txrx_lib.h >>> @@ -12,26 +12,39 @@ >>> * act: action to store onto Rx buffers related to XDP buffer parts >>> * >>> * Set action that should be taken before putting Rx buffer from first frag >>> - * to one before last.
